Comment la mise à niveau d'Ethereum Cancun transforme l'évolutivité : des percées techniques aux applications pratiques

robot
Création du résumé en cours

Points clés

  • Le 13 mars 2024, Ethereum a implémenté la mise à niveau Cancun-Deneb sur le réseau principal, ce qui constitue une étape clé dans la feuille de route d'Ethereum 2.0 pour l'introduction du Proto-Danksharding.
  • Grâce aux quatre propositions d'amélioration d'Ethereum que sont EIP-4844, EIP-1153, EIP-4788 et EIP-6780, cette mise à niveau a considérablement réduit les coûts de transaction de Layer 2 et amélioré le débit du réseau.
  • Le Proto-Danksharding introduit une structure de données Blob, permettant aux Rollups de Layer 2 de stocker des données temporaires à un coût réduit, propulsant le TPS (transactions par seconde) vers un niveau de 100 000.
  • Les principaux risques liés à la mise à niveau incluent les problèmes de compatibilité des contrats intelligents existants et les défis d'intégration des nouvelles technologies de stockage de données.

De Proof of Work à Proof of Stake : Renforcement des bases de l'extension d'Ethereum

La transition d'Ethereum vers le mécanisme de Proof of Stake (PoS) n'est pas seulement une mise à jour de l'algorithme de consensus, mais constitue une base nécessaire pour préparer les technologies de Sharding à venir. À l'ère de la PoW, les mineurs obtenaient le droit de comptabilisation par la compétition de puissance de calcul ; tandis que dans le système PoS, les validateurs sont attribués de manière aléatoire à différents shards en fonction du montant d'ETH mis en jeu.

La beauté de ce design réside dans le fait que : le mécanisme de répartition aléatoire réduit considérablement la probabilité que les shards soient attaqués, tout en permettant à l'ensemble du réseau de traiter simultanément un nombre de transactions multiplié en décentralisant le travail de validation sur plusieurs shards parallèles. Par rapport à l'inefficacité du Proof of Work qui nécessite la participation de l'ensemble du réseau pour les calculs, le Sharding dans un environnement PoS permet une véritable gestion parallèle.

L'ère Cancun après la mise à niveau Ethereum Shanghai

Si la mise à niveau de Shanghai a jeté les bases du staking, la mise à niveau ultérieure de Cancun représente une transformation systématique de l'efficacité du réseau. La mise à niveau Cancun-Deneb (également connue sous le nom de Dencun) n'est pas apparue de nulle part, mais a été soigneusement conçue sur la base de quatre propositions d'amélioration spécifiques d'Ethereum (EIPs) :

Interprétation des propositions d'amélioration clés

EIP-4844 : Mise en œuvre de Proto-Danksharding C'est la proposition la plus révolutionnaire des quatre. Elle introduit le concept de “Blob” (objet binaire volumineux) - une structure de stockage de données temporaire qui peut être automatiquement nettoyée après environ 18 jours dans le bloc. Pour les Rollup de niveau 2, cela signifie qu'ils n'ont pas besoin de stocker toutes les données de transaction de manière permanente sur la chaîne principale Ethereum, mais peuvent plutôt utiliser un espace de stockage temporaire à bas prix. Quel est le résultat ? Les frais de Gas sur le niveau 2 peuvent diminuer de 50 % à 90 %.

EIP-1153 : Optimisation du stockage à court terme Cette proposition réduit la consommation de Gas des contrats lors des opérations de stockage, en introduisant un mécanisme de stockage temporaire (transient storage), permettant aux contrats intelligents de stocker temporairement des données au sein d'une même transaction sans nécessiter d'opérations de stockage permanentes coûteuses.

EIP-4788 : Pont de communication inter-chaînes Cette proposition expose directement l'état de la chaîne de balises à la couche d'exécution, jetant les bases pour des interactions inter-chaînes plus complexes à l'avenir, et renforce l'interopérabilité d'Ethereum avec d'autres réseaux de blockchain.

EIP-6780 : Renforcement de la sécurité des contrats intelligents En limitant les cas d'utilisation de l'opcode SELFDESTRUCT, le risque de destruction de contrats malveillants est réduit, renforçant ainsi la sécurité des fonds des utilisateurs.

Mise en œuvre progressive de Danksharding

Le Danksharding, en tant que concept proposé par le chercheur d'Ethereum Dankrad Feist, représente le schéma de sharding de la phase finale d'Ethereum 2.0 (Serenity). Contrairement au sharding traditionnel qui attribue des producteurs de blocs indépendants à chaque shard, le Danksharding nécessite seulement un proposeur de blocs, optimisant la disponibilité des données grâce à une architecture simplifiée.

Proto-Danksharding est la mise en œuvre prototype de cette vision - il conserve les caractéristiques clés du Danksharding, mais adopte une transition plus fluide. Avec l'introduction de la structure de données Blob, les applications Layer 2 peuvent en bénéficier immédiatement, tandis que le cadre complet de Danksharding est toujours en cours de développement.

Comment les transactions Blob changent l'écosystème

Les transactions Blob sont un produit direct du Proto-Danksharding. Les transactions Ethereum traditionnelles nécessitent d'enregistrer toutes les données de manière permanente sur la blockchain, ce qui entraîne une augmentation exponentielle des coûts de stockage à mesure que le réseau se développe. En revanche, les transactions Blob permettent d'attacher de grandes quantités de données sous forme de paquets temporaires aux transactions, ces données étant nettoyées après vérification, réduisant ainsi considérablement la pression sur les coûts pour les développeurs.

Pour les Layer 2 Rollup (comme Arbitrum, Optimism, etc.), cela signifie qu'ils peuvent soumettre des preuves de transaction en masse sur Ethereum à un coût inférieur, les utilisateurs finaux bénéficiant de frais de Gas considérablement réduits.

Les cinq impacts réels de l'upgrade de Cancun sur l'écologie

1. Amélioration de l'échelle de la scalabilité Le Proto-Danksharding permet une percée qualitative du débit des Rollups Layer 2 en introduisant un stockage de données temporaire. L'objectif de 100 000 TPS proposé dans la feuille de route “Surge” officielle d'Ethereum devient plus atteignable.

2. Réduction significative des coûts pour les utilisateurs La courbe de coût des données Blob est complètement indépendante des frais de Gas conventionnels et est généralement moins chère. Cela se traduit directement par une réduction des frais de Gas de 50 à 90 % pour les utilisateurs de Layer 2, et parfois même moins.

3. Gestion intelligente du stockage des données Le mécanisme de stockage temporaire d'EIP-1153 offre aux développeurs de contrats intelligents une option de stockage plus flexible : pour les données nécessitant seulement un stockage à court terme, il n'est plus nécessaire de payer le coût élevé du stockage permanent.

4. Renforcement de l'interopérabilité de l'écosystème inter-chaînes EIP-4788 fournit une meilleure base technique pour les futures passerelles inter-chaînes et applications multichaînes en ouvrant l'état de la chaîne de balises à la couche d'exécution.

5. Mise à niveau de la sécurité de l'écosystème des contrats intelligents L'EIP-6780 limite l'abus de SELFDESTRUCT, réduisant certaines vecteurs d'attaque de vulnérabilités de contrat connues, protégeant les actifs des utilisateurs tout en réduisant les coûts d'audit.

Défis réels auxquels l'upgrade est confronté

Bien que les perspectives de mise à niveau de Cancun soient prometteuses, sa mise en œuvre n'est pas sans risques. Tout d'abord, certains anciens contrats intelligents peuvent rencontrer des problèmes de compatibilité avec les nouvelles méthodes de calcul de Gas ou les mécanismes de stockage, nécessitant une adaptation proactive de la part des équipes de projet. Deuxièmement, bien que la nouvelle structure de données Blob soit plus efficace, elle exige également que les logiciels des nœuds soient mis à jour et optimisés en conséquence, ce qui pose des exigences techniques aux opérateurs de nœuds du réseau.

De plus, le Danksharding complet est encore en développement. Bien que le Proto-Danksharding ait apporté des avantages immédiats, la mise en œuvre de la solution finale doit encore être testée avec prudence.

Chronologie des mises à niveau et progrès de la mise en œuvre

La mise à niveau de Cancun était initialement prévue pour octobre 2023, mais a été reportée au premier semestre 2024 afin de garantir des tests et des audits suffisants. Finalement, la mise à niveau a été officiellement mise en œuvre sur le réseau principal Ethereum le 13 mars 2024 (époque 269,568 de l'ensemble des validateurs).

Les opérateurs de nœuds et les stakers doivent mettre à jour leur version de logiciel client en temps opportun pour assurer la compatibilité avec le réseau mis à niveau.

Perspectives : Une nouvelle ère pour l'évolutivité d'Ethereum

La mise à niveau Cancun-Deneb symbolise un tournant clé pour Ethereum, passant de la conception théorique à l'utilisabilité pratique. Avec l'introduction du Proto-Danksharding, l'écosystème Layer 2 a gagné en espace de respiration, les coûts pour les utilisateurs ont considérablement diminué, et l'expérience utilisateur des applications DeFi et NFT s'est nettement améliorée.

Un sens plus profond réside dans le fait que la mise à niveau Cancun a validé la faisabilité de la vision de sharding d'Ethereum, posant une base solide pour la réalisation finale du Danksharding. À l'avenir, lorsque le schéma complet de sharding sera déployé, Ethereum devrait pouvoir dépasser le plafond de performance de 100 000 TPS, devenant ainsi un véritable pilier fiable de l'infrastructure financière mondiale.

Pour les développeurs, les stakers et les utilisateurs ordinaires, l'importance de cette mise à jour est évidente : des frais réduits, une vitesse accrue et une meilleure expérience. C'est également la clé pour qu'Ethereum reste en tête dans la compétition avec d'autres blockchains à haute performance.

ETH1.76%
ARB0.15%
OP-0.83%
Voir l'original
Cette page peut inclure du contenu de tiers fourni à des fins d'information uniquement. Gate ne garantit ni l'exactitude ni la validité de ces contenus, n’endosse pas les opinions exprimées, et ne fournit aucun conseil financier ou professionnel à travers ces informations. Voir la section Avertissement pour plus de détails.
  • Récompense
  • Commentaire
  • Reposter
  • Partager
Commentaire
0/400
Aucun commentaire
  • Épingler
Trader les cryptos partout et à tout moment
qrCode
Scan pour télécharger Gate app
Communauté
Français (Afrique)
  • 简体中文
  • English
  • Tiếng Việt
  • 繁體中文
  • Español
  • Русский
  • Français (Afrique)
  • Português (Portugal)
  • Bahasa Indonesia
  • 日本語
  • بالعربية
  • Українська
  • Português (Brasil)